2014 Philippe Colin Chardonnay "Chassagne-Montrachet Les Chaumees"

Philippe Colin 2014 Chassagne-Montrachet Les Chaumees

Winery: Philippe Colin

Vintage: 2014

Wine Name/Vineyard: "Chassagne-Montrachet Les Chaumees"

Wine Category: Chardonnay

Grape blend: 100% Chardonnay

Bottle size: 750 ml

Region: Burgundy

State or country: France

Price: $90

Cases produced: unknown

KWG Score: 93.2 (based on 4 reviews)

Ken's Wine Rating: Very Good+ (93)

Review date: May 23, 2016

Wine Review: This light yellow colored Chardonnay is very very good. It opens with a light green apple and faint vanilla oak bouquet. On the palate, this wine is medium bodied, nicely balanced, soft and elegant. The flavor profile is a tasty lemon and green apple blend with notes of mild minerality. I also detected faint hints of old oak and white pepper. The finish is dry and very refreshing. I would pair this gem of a Chard with grilled swordfish. Enjoy - Ken

Winemaker Notes: Les Chaumees is a consistent, very elegant, mineral-driven wine due to the high limestone content of the soils in which it is grown. Flint and smoke on the nose segue to an impossibly structured palate that showcases bright citrus fruit flavors and rounded edges that taper off into a focused, lingering finish.
